I don't use any of the Adobe programs for my photo editing, mostly based on price and the steep learning curve to the programs.

I use Corel Paint Shop Pro X2. I think the price is down to under $75 at most places now.

On their website you can download a free trial version (http://www.corel.com/servlet/Satellite/us/en/Product/1184951547051#versionTabview=tab1&tabview=tab6)of the full program to try for 30 days. That's how I made up my mind that's what I wanted to get.

I find that it does almost everything my dad's full $600 version of Adobe Photoshop does, but mine is alot easier to learn (at least for me, and even my dad admits it sounds easier) and cost a heck of alot less.
